America's public lands and waters mean the world to me. As a naturalized U.S. citizen, they are among the things that make me most proud to call this country home. For me, their meaning goes beyond the incredible diversity of landscapes and wildlife. 

Every time I share a photo, my hope is that it sparks the same sense of awe in someone else, and that awe turns into appreciation, and appreciation turns into stewardship. These places had captured my imagination before I ever set foot on U.S. soil, through the cartoons and movies of my childhood that made these landscapes feel like something out of a dream. Now, as a self-taught photography enthusiast, I am lucky enough to return to them year after year, chasing the same sense of awe I hope to pass on to friends and family via photographs.
